2. Indonesian Market: Island Microgrid Project Solving Power Shortages  

2.1 Project Background

Indonesia, the world’s largest archipelago, faces uneven power infrastructure development, with many remote islands still relying on expensive and polluting diesel generators. A particular island community struggled with unstable power supply and high electricity costs, prompting the local government to seek a  "PV + Storage" microgrid solution  for sustainable energy.  

2.2 SevenEco Energy’s Solution

- System Configuration:  

  - PV Modules: 500kW high-efficiency monocrystalline solar panels, designed for tropical climates with salt spray corrosion resistance.  

  - Energy Storage: 1MWh lithium iron phosphate (LFP) battery system, offering long cycle life and deep discharge capability.  

  - Smart Control System: SevenAn’s self-developed Energy Management System (EMS) enables intelligent dispatching of solar, storage, and diesel backup to ensure 24/7 stable power supply.  

-  Key Benefits:  

  -  Cost Savings : Reduced energy costs by over 30% compared to diesel generation, with a payback period of  <5 years .  

  -  Environmental Impact : Cut CO₂ emissions by  ~800 tons annually , supporting Indonesia’s carbon neutrality goals.  

  -  Reliability : Equipped with black-start capability to maintain critical loads during extreme weather.

 3. Malaysian Market: Commercial & Industrial PV-Storage Project Cutting Energy Costs   

 3.1 Project Background   

Malaysia’s industrial electricity prices are relatively high, with significant peak/off-peak tariff differentials. A large manufacturing plant sought to install a  rooftop PV + storage system  to reduce costs and increase renewable energy usage.

3.2 SevenEco Energy’s Solution   

-  System Configuration :  

  - PV System : 1.2MW rooftop distributed solar array using bifacial modules for higher efficiency.  

  - Energy Storage : 600kWh battery storage for  peak shaving  (charging during low-tariff periods and discharging during peak hours).  

  - AI-Powered Energy Management : Optimized charge/discharge strategies using predictive algorithms to maximize savings.  

-  Key Benefits :  

  - Economic Gains : Solar covered  80% of daytime demand , and peak shaving reduced annual electricity costs by  >25% .  

  - Climate Adaptability : Enhanced cooling design for Malaysia’s hot and humid conditions, ensuring low maintenance.  

  - Policy Compliance : Aligned with Malaysia’s  Net Energy Metering (NEM) scheme , allowing excess power to be sold back to the grid.
